On 07/08/2014 07:37 AM, Richard Purdie wrote:
> On Fri, 2014-07-04 at 02:16 -0700, Robert Yang wrote:
>> The "RDEPENDS =" should be replaced by RDEPENDS_${PN}, the similar to
>> RRECOMMENDS
>
> Why?
>
> PACKAGES = "" for these recipes so there is no ${PN} package to add
> these dependencies too?

Ah, right, we should not set this if no PACKAGES.

>
> I suspect this is from your image class modifications but did you test
> without those modifications?

Yes, it is from the image class modifications. I tested it separately,
the bitbake core-image-minimal buildtools-tarball were the same w/o
these changes, I don't know why it works after your explanations, I
tried to print the self.rdepends_pkg from cache.py after patched:

self.rdepends_pkg: {'core-image-minimal': ['packagegroup-core-boot', 
'run-postinsts', 'run-postinsts']}

maybe that's why it works.

Anyway, we should drop this since PACKAGES = "".
